Private investigation into design costs sheds no light

Money talks. And us hacks are always keen to investigate the financial investment that clients make with consultancies. In other words, ‘what’s the fee?’ is a question we like to ask.

This produces much evasion. But few responses are as suspicious as that advanced for the National Criminal Intelligence Service. ‘That is really sensitive information to NCIS, which is a particularly private organisation,’ frets the PR concerned.

Forgive us if we fail to see the connection. Are the Mr Biggs of organised crime bothered about what the super-sleuths spend on design?
